The other day, when we were planning my three-day visit to [livejournal.com profile] stonebender's, I told him I planned to bring along my new one-dollar ice-cream maker. I asked him what flavor he might like to make. "I don't know; caramel?" So I went looking on the web for caramel ice cream recipes. Most were pretty involved, but I don't mind that. One that looked relatively simple and really delicious (besides being from the Perfect Scoop guy) was this recipe for salted caramel ice cream.

I made it tonight. It's easier than it looks, provided you have all the equipment handy (I especially recommend making sure you have the water-bath bowls in the sizes you'll need). And oh, dear, is it ever decadent. Next time, I'd probably skip the praline step and just have the ice cream without the stuff in it, but that's my preference in general, anyway.

The vegan chocolate cake I made tonight is way yummy. Very cheap, very easy to make, VERY moist. I mostly don't like cake, unless it's practically moist enough to be a steamed pudding. This one's like that, and a few bites were plenty. The gang likes it, too.
